15 Mythology and Folklore Trivia Questions and Answers

  1. In Greek mythology, who was the ruler of the gods? Zeus.
  2. What is the name of the hammer wielded by Thor in Norse mythology? Mjölnir.
  3. According to Japanese folklore, what creature is often depicted as a large, intelligent, cat-like being with the power to shape-shift? Tanuki or Kitsune (both are shape-shifters, but the tanuki is more closely associated with the description).
  4. In Egyptian mythology, who is the goddess of magic and motherhood? Isis.
  5. What is the name of the legendary city that was said to have sunk into the ocean “in a single day and night of misfortune”? Atlantis.
  6. In Celtic folklore, what are the small, humanoid creatures known for their skills in metalworking and their hidden homes? Leprechauns.
  7. Who is the Roman equivalent of the Greek goddess Athena? Minerva.
  8. In Hindu mythology, who is the god of fire? Agni.
  9. According to Maori folklore, what is the name of the demigod who fished up the North Island of New Zealand? Maui.
  10. What tree is Yggdrasil in Norse mythology? The World Tree, an immense ash tree.
  11. Who is the Aztec god of the sun and war? Huitzilopochtli.
  12. In Slavic folklore, who is the winter witch associated with cold, death, and winter? Baba Yaga.
  13. What mythical creature is often depicted as a horse with a single horn in Western folklore? Unicorn.
  14. In Chinese mythology, who is the dragon king responsible for rainfall and water control? The Dragon King, or Longwang.
  15. What legendary sword was said to be embedded in a stone until it was pulled out by the rightful king of England? Excalibur.
